The HPX Gas Handling Manifold is an ultra-high purity (UHP) gas pressure regulation and purification system that allows for two Xenon Xe 129 Gas Blend cylinders, one NF-grade UHP nitrogen cylinder and one industrial nitrogen cylinder to be connected to the HPX Hyperpolarizer.
An electrically-powered assembly of devices designed for the production and measurement of hyperpolarized xenon (Xe) gas delivered to the lungs to improve lung magnetic resonance imaging (MRI) during assessment of lung function. It consists of a hyperpolarized xenon generator, a measurement station, and gas delivery equipment. The system includes a wide variety of technologies such as laser-based hyperpolarization, magnetic field generation to slow relaxation of hyperpolarized Xe, and nuclear magnetic resonance (NMR) based measurement of hyperpolarized Xe; it is used with a disposable delivery bag for measured dosing of hyperpolarized Xe to the patient via a mask/mouthpiece.
